Transaction 07e1088582c42416626a4e0643a686b53ca586710fa4c6650bfd1b462946e0b0

182 Input
2 Outputs
  • 07e1088582c42416626a4e0643a686b53ca586710fa4c6650bfd1b462946e0b0:0
  • value  253956305
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 07e1088582c42416626a4e0643a686b53ca586710fa4c6650bfd1b462946e0b0:1
  • value  3053872
    address  3CeGvnmcJZp4BTADEjHaiiABVCLFS31MAM